SISTERS OF ST. FRANCIS v. EON PROPERTIES

No. 45A05-1110-PL-587.

968 N.E.2d 305 (2012)

SISTERS OF ST. FRANCIS HEALTH SERVICES, INC., Appellant-Defendant, v. EON PROPERTIES, LLC, Appellee-Plaintiff.

Court of Appeals of Indiana.

May 29, 2012.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Steven P. Lammers , Robert A. Anderson , Krieg Devault LLP, Schererville, IN, Libby Y. Goodknight , Krieg Devault LLP, Indianapolis, IN, Attorneys for Appellant.

Glenn W. Kuchel , Green and Kuchel, P.C., Schererville, IN, Attorney for Appellee.


OPINION

BAKER, Judge.

Here, a company that owns commercial property entered into a lease agreement and a series of amendments with a hospital. The amendments reduced the hospital's space, thereby allowing a new tenant to lease that space under a separate lease and reducing the hospital's rent obligation.
